Safety Tats



I received in the mail as part of a product review Safety Tats. Safety Tats are made for putting on your young child when you go to the zoo, amusement park or any family event that there may be a large group of people attending. Do you have a young child that always runs off and you panic unable to find her or him? Then this is for you. The purpose of Safety Tats is it is a Removable Tattoo that gets imprinted on the skin you can have them pre-printed, write on or design your own the price starts at $9.99 and goes up and lasts up to 2 weeks. How you put it on is simple you rub the area with an alcohol prep pad, peel the large backing off, apply to skin and hold for 20 seconds. To remove you would hold the skin next to the tattoo and peel the corner and go low and slow keeping it close to the skin surface as when you pull it off quickly it would have them same effect as removing a piece of tape on skin and make your child uncomfortable. Remember once removed it will not stick again. You can visit their website at www.safteytats.com and check out all the great items they offer.
